The average bus between Matlock and Leith takes 9h 2m and the fastest bus takes 7h 39m. The bus service runs several times per day from Matlock to Leith.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run 4 times a day between Matlock and Leith. The earliest departure is at 9:06 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Matlock is at 9:16 PM which arrives into Leith at 7:45 AM. All services require a transfer at Eyre Street/Moor Market ES3 and take an average of 9h 2m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Matlock to Leith. However, there are services departing from Matlock station and arriving at Leith station via Edinburgh, Bus Station station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 2m.
Matlock to Leith bus services, operated by Stagecoach Yorkshire, depart from Meadowhall Interchange/B1 station.
Matlock to Leith bus services, operated by Stagecoach Yorkshire, arrive at Edinburgh, Bus Station.
The distance between Matlock and Leith is 332 km. The road distance is 409 km.
FlixBus operates a bus from Meadowhall Interchange/B1 to Edinburgh, Bus Station hourly. Tickets cost £22–40 and the journey takes 5h 25m. National Express also services this route twice daily.
